Understanding the Debt Payment Agreement Sample Letter
A Debt Payment Agreement Sample Letter is essentially a formal document that outlines the terms and conditions under which a debt will be repaid. It serves as a legally binding contract, ensuring that both the lender and the borrower are clear on their respective responsibilities. The importance of having such an agreement in writing cannot be overstated, as it helps prevent misunderstandings and provides a clear record of the agreed-upon terms.
- It clearly identifies the parties involved (lender and borrower).
- It specifies the exact amount of the debt.
- It details the repayment schedule, including the amount of each instalment and the due dates.
- It may also include details on interest rates, late payment penalties, and any collateral or security provided.
Drafting this agreement might seem like a chore, but it offers significant benefits:
- Clarity and Transparency: Ensures both parties understand the obligations.
- Dispute Resolution: Provides a reference point if disagreements arise.
- Record Keeping: Offers a verifiable record of the agreement.
Here’s a quick look at some core components you might find:
| Component | Description |
|---|---|
| Principal Amount | The original sum of money borrowed. |
| Interest Rate | The percentage charged on the outstanding balance. |
| Payment Schedule | Frequency and amount of payments. |
| Late Fees | Penalties for missed or late payments. |
Debt Payment Agreement Sample Letter for a Personal Loan
Subject: Debt Payment Agreement - [Your Name] and [Friend's Name]
Dear [Friend's Name],
This letter serves as a formal agreement for the repayment of the personal loan of £[Amount] that I provided to you on [Date].
We agree that the total amount to be repaid is £[Amount]. This amount will be repaid in [Number] monthly instalments of £[Monthly Payment Amount], with the first payment due on [First Payment Date] and subsequent payments due on the [Day] of each month thereafter.
Should any payment be more than [Number] days late, a late fee of £[Late Fee Amount] will be applied to the outstanding balance. This agreement is made in good faith, and I trust that you will adhere to the agreed repayment schedule.
Please sign and return a copy of this letter to confirm your understanding and agreement to these terms.
Sincerely,
[Your Name]
Agreed and Accepted:
[Friend's Name] (Signature)
[Friend's Name] (Printed Name)
Date: [Date]
Debt Payment Agreement Sample Letter for Business Expenses
Subject: Formal Agreement for Repayment of Business Expenses - [Your Company Name] and [Supplier Name]
Dear [Supplier Contact Person],
This letter confirms our agreement regarding the outstanding balance of £[Amount] for services/goods provided by [Supplier Name] to [Your Company Name] on [Date(s)].
Due to current cash flow challenges, we propose the following repayment plan for the outstanding amount. We will make [Number] instalment payments of £[Monthly Payment Amount] each, commencing on [First Payment Date] and continuing on the [Day] of each subsequent month until the full balance is cleared. The final payment will be due on [Final Payment Date].
We understand the importance of timely payments and are committed to fulfilling this obligation. We request your acknowledgement and agreement to this revised payment schedule. Please sign and return a copy of this letter to confirm your acceptance.
We appreciate your understanding and continued partnership.
Yours faithfully,
[Your Name]
[Your Title]
[Your Company Name]
Agreed and Accepted:
[Supplier Representative Name]
[Supplier Representative Title]
[Supplier Name]
Date: [Date]
